Nutritional Profile of Sugarcane Juice
Sugarcane juice is more than just a sweet thirst-quencher—it is a natural source of carbohydrates, vitamins, minerals, phytonutrients, and powerful antioxidants:
- Carbohydrates: High in natural sugars, providing instant energy.
- Vitamins: Contains vitamin C, vitamin B-complex (particularly B1, B2, B3, B5, B6), and trace amounts of vitamin A.
- Minerals: Enriched with calcium, magnesium, iron, potassium, zinc, and manganese.
- Phytonutrients: Polyphenols and flavonoids that combat oxidative stress.
- Alpha hydroxy acids (AHAs): Known for exfoliating and renewing skin.
This robust nutritional portfolio supports a wide variety of therapeutic and cosmetic benefits.
Benefits of Sugarcane Juice for Skin
Several compounds in sugarcane juice make it highly beneficial for skin care, whether consumed internally or applied topically:
1. Gentle Exfoliation and Deep Cleansing
Sugarcane juice is rich in alpha hydroxy acids (AHAs), notably glycolic acid, which gently exfoliates the skin. AHAs remove dead skin cells, unclog pores, and clear surface impurities, resulting in smoother, brighter skin texture.
2. Natural Moisturization
Natural sugars trap moisture, keeping skin hydrated and supple. Regular application combats dryness, flakiness, and rough patches, leading to consistently soft skin.
3. Acne and Blemish Control
Sugarcane juice’s antimicrobial and anti-inflammatory properties help fight acne-causing bacteria. Glycolic acid unclogs pores and reduces sebum, minimizing pimples, blackheads, and breakouts. Over time, scars and blemishes fade, revealing a clearer complexion.
4. Anti-aging Benefits
Loaded with antioxidants like flavonoids and vitamin C, sugarcane juice neutralizes free radicals, which damage skin and speed up aging. Its regular use can soften fine lines, wrinkles, and age spots, promoting youthful radiance.
5. Evens Skin Tone
The exfoliating acids accelerate cell turnover, gradually fading dark spots, hyperpigmentation, and sun damage. This process supports a smoother, more even, and luminous skin tone.
6. Soothes Irritation and Heals Minor Wounds
Anti-inflammatory and wound-healing properties help soothe sunburn, rashes, or insect bites. The cooling, hydrating effect provides immediate relief and helps reduce redness and swelling.

Benefits of Sugarcane Juice for Hair
Sugarcane juice is a nutrient-rich tonic for healthier, stronger, and shinier hair:
- Scalp Hydration: AHAs and natural sugars moisturize and balance scalp pH, reducing dryness and dandruff.
- Nourishment: Vitamins, minerals, and amino acids fortify the roots and follicles, promoting healthy hair growth and preventing breakage.
- Conditioning: Adds natural shine and softness, detangling hair strands and improving texture.
- Dandruff Reduction: Clears flaky buildup through gentle exfoliation and supports a healthier scalp microbiome.
Using sugarcane juice as a rinse or in hair masks may leave hair glossy, smooth, and full of volume.
Health Benefits of Sugarcane Juice
In traditional and modern nutrition, sugarcane juice is praised for its wide-ranging health effects:
1. Boosts Energy Instantly
High levels of natural sugars and carbohydrates are quickly metabolized into glucose, providing an immediate energy surge—ideal for hot climates, athletes, and those with low energy.
2. Supports Digestive Health
The potassium and dietary fiber in sugarcane juice aid in digestion, balance the stomach’s pH, and prevent constipation and bloating.
3. Enhances Liver Function & Fights Jaundice
Sugarcane juice is traditionally used as a liver tonic. It’s alkaline, supports detoxification, and may aid in faster recovery from jaundice by replenishing lost nutrients and improving bile secretion.
4. Immunity Booster
Rich in antioxidants like vitamin C, flavonoids, and polyphenols, sugarcane juice strengthens immunity and defends against infections.
5. Protects Kidneys & Acts as a Natural Diuretic
Its natural diuretic effect helps flush out toxins, supports kidney health, and can reduce risk of urinary tract infections.
6. Supports Healthy Bones & Teeth
With significant calcium, magnesium, and phosphorus content, sugarcane juice helps maintain bone density and dental health.
7. Assists in Weight Management
When consumed in moderation, sugarcane juice’s low glycemic index and ability to induce satiety may help curb cravings for unhealthy snacks.
8. Improves Heart Health
The antioxidants and potassium promote cardiovascular wellness by regulating blood pressure and reducing harmful cholesterol buildup.
9. Alleviates Dehydration
High water content, coupled with essential electrolytes, make sugarcane juice effective against dehydration and heat stroke, especially in hot weather.
How to Use Sugarcane Juice for Skin and Hair
Sugarcane juice is versatile and can be incorporated into your skin and hair routines in simple, natural ways:
- As a Skin Toner: Soak a cotton ball in fresh sugarcane juice and gently dab on cleansed face. It tightens pores and refreshes skin.
- DIY Face Mask: Mix 2 tbsp sugarcane juice, 1 tbsp lemon juice, and 1 tsp honey. Apply, leave for 15–20 minutes, then rinse to reveal bright, hydrated skin.
- Exfoliating Scrub: Blend sugarcane juice with oatmeal or gram flour for a gentle scrub suitable for all skin types.
- Soothing Compress: Apply chilled sugarcane juice with a clean cloth to areas of sunburn or irritation for relief.
- Hair Rinse: After shampooing, pour sugarcane juice on your scalp and lengths. Leave for a few minutes, massage lightly, and rinse thoroughly to add shine and nourish follicles.
Tip: Always use freshly extracted, unsweetened sugarcane juice for topical applications. Conduct a patch test before applying it fully to ensure you do not experience adverse reactions.
Precautions and Side Effects
- Hygiene Matters: Unhygienically prepared juice can introduce contaminants. Always choose juice from a clean, trusted source.
- Moderate Intake: Although natural, excessive consumption may contribute to weight gain or affect blood sugar, especially for diabetics.
- Possible Allergies: Rare, but individuals may develop sensitivity—start with a small topical test.
- Pregnancy & Medical Conditions: Consult a physician before regular intake if you are pregnant, breastfeeding, or have chronic health issues.
